The 750 MM 6 Stand Continuous Cold Rolling Mill is a highly capable and versatile cold rolling solution designed for producing low alloy steel strips with a thickness range of 2-3mm. This mill features a 6-stand configuration, allowing for progressive and effective thickness reduction in a single pass.
The mill is equipped with advanced features that enable high-quality, high-efficiency production:
Customizable Design: The mill can be tailored to meet specific customer requirements, ensuring optimal performance for the desired application.
Powerful Drives: The mill utilizes high-power DC motors, with 1000 kW for the main machinery and 750 kW for the coiler, providing ample power for the rolling process.
Precise Thickness Control: The mill incorporates a hydraulic Automatic Gauge Control (AGC) system, which enables precise control of strip thickness, roll force, and tension/speed, ensuring tight tolerances and consistent product quality.
Advanced Automation: The mill's control system integrates PLC-based process control, remote communication, and advanced functions such as strip tail automatic deceleration, accurate stopping, and multi-point stopping, enhancing operational efficiency and safety.
Versatile Rolling Capabilities: The mill can handle a wide range of low alloy steel grades, with a yield strength up to 360 MPa, making it suitable for a diverse range of applications.
Robust Construction: The mill's sturdy design, with a housing weight of around 70 tons, ensures reliable and long-lasting performance, even under demanding operating conditions.
Model No. | 750mm 4-Hi 6-Tandem CRM |
MaterialL | Low alloy steel |
Material thickness (mm) | 2.0-3.0 |
Material width (mm) | 500-650 |
Output thickness (mm) | 0.4-0.6 |
Rolling pressure (KN) | 6500 |
Backup roller size (mm) | Φ650×700 |
Work roller (mm) | Φ225×750 |
Mill stand | 6 stands |
Drive mode | By work roller |
Main motor | DC motor |
Reducer | Combined gearbox |
Decoiler (option) | Φ610×650 |
Recoiler (option) | Φ508×750 |
Rolling speed (m/min.) | 300-420 |
Accumulator | Disc type |
Recoiler tension (KN) | 0-45 |
Screw-down mode | Hydraulic AGC |
DC speed regulation | Simens |
Electrical control | Simens |

Loading and decoiling →shearing→ welding (welding machine provided by the user) → disc storage looper →rotating high-bracket→ vertical roller guide → F1 four-high mill (thickness measurement, tension measurement) → F2 four-high mill (thickness measurement) → F3 four-high mill (thickness measurement) → F4 four-high mill (thickness measurement) → F5 four-high mill (thickness measurement) → F6 four-high mill (thickness measurement) → Exit platform (de-oiling) → shearing → recoiler → unloading

Q1. What is a continuous rolling mill?
A continuous rolling mill is a type of metal rolling mill that is designed for high-volume production and continuous processing of metal strips or coils.
Q2. What materials can be processed on a continuous rolling mill?
Continuous rolling mills can process a wide range of materials, including steel, aluminum, copper, nickel, titanium, and other non-ferrous metals.
Q3. How does a continuous rolling mill work?
Continuous rolling mills consist of multiple stands arranged in a tandem configuration. Metal strips or coils are fed into the first stand, and as they pass through each stand, the rolls progressively reduce the thickness and increase the length of the metal.
Q4. What control systems are used in continuous rolling mills?
Continuous rolling mills are equipped with advanced automation and control systems that monitor and adjust parameters such as roll gap, rolling speed, temperature, and tension, ensuring precise rolling specifications and maintaining product quality.
Q5. Can continuous rolling mills produce different sizes and shapes?
Yes, continuous rolling mills can be adjusted to produce different thicknesses, widths, and shapes of metal strips or coils by changing the rolling parameters and adjusting the mill configuration.
